## Description

V4C is seeking a Data Scientist with strong experience in Databricks, Python, machine learning, and Master Data Management (MDM) to help build data-driven solutions that support healthcare and member engagement initiatives. The ideal candidate will have experience working with large, complex healthcare datasets and transforming disparate data sources into reliable, analytics-ready data.

Key Responsibilities

-   Develop and productionize machine learning models, statistical analyses, and predictive analytics using Python and Databricks.
-   Build and maintain scalable data science workflows using Databricks, PySpark, SQL, Delta Lake, and related cloud data technologies.
-   Work with MDM processes and frameworks to establish consistent, accurate, and trusted master data across multiple source systems.
-   Analyze and resolve data quality, duplication, matching, and entity-resolution issues across member, provider, patient, and other healthcare-related datasets.
-   Partner with Data Engineering, Product, Analytics, and business stakeholders to translate healthcare business problems into data science solutions.
-   Develop data validation, profiling, and quality-monitoring approaches to improve reliability of analytical datasets.
-   Perform exploratory data analysis and identify trends, patterns, and insights that can support member engagement and healthcare outcomes.
-   Contribute to feature engineering, model evaluation, experimentation, and deployment of data science solutions into production.
-   Ensure data solutions follow applicable healthcare data privacy, security, and governance requirements, including HIPAA where applicable.
-   Document models, datasets, assumptions, methodologies, and data lineage to support reproducibility and governance.

Required Qualifications  
  

-   8+ years of experience in Data Science, Machine Learning, Advanced Analytics, or a related field.
-   Strong hands-on experience with Databricks and PySpark.
-   Advanced Python and SQL skills.
-   Experience developing and deploying machine learning or predictive models.
-   Strong understanding of Master Data Management (MDM) concepts, including:
-   Data matching and deduplication
-   Entity resolution
-   Golden/master records
-   Data standardization
-   Data quality
-   Reference/master data
-   Experience working with large-scale structured and semi-structured datasets.
-   Experience with Delta Lake / Lakehouse architecture.
-   Strong understanding of data governance, data quality, and data lineage.
-   Experience working with healthcare, payer, provider, patient, or other regulated data is preferred.
-   Experience working in a HIPAA-regulated environment is highly desirable.
